Rig Veda 2.27.8 — Ādityas
Verse 8 of 17 from Sukta 2.27 (Ādityas) in Mandala 2 of the Rig Veda.
Rig Veda 2.27.8
Sanskrit (Devanagari)
तिस्रो भूमीर्धारयन तरीन्रुत दयून तरीणि वरता विदथे अन्तरेषाम | रतेनादित्या महि वो महित्वं तदर्यमन वरुण मित्र चारु
IAST Romanisation
tisro bhūmīrdhārayan trīnruta dyūn trīṇi vratā vidathe antareṣām | ṛtenādityā mahi vo mahitvaṃ tadaryaman varuṇa mitra cāru
English Translation (Griffith)
With their support they stay three earths, three heavens; three are their functions in the Gods’ assembly. Mighty through Law, Ādityas, is your greatness; fair is it, Aryaman, Varuṇa, and Mitra.
